Given the integer array dailyScores with the size of ARR_VALS, write a for loop that sets sumBonus to the total bonus points. Scores above 150 contain bonus points.
Ex: If the input is 61,225,105,97,235,187,74,35, then the output is:
Bonus sum: 197
Note: To find a bonus point, the point is subtracted by the base point of 150.
